在GIS里面,不规则的多边形,怎么用Python求,当它的x坐标值最小的时候,其对应的y值是多少。

在GIS里面,不规则的多边形,怎么用Python求,当它的x坐标值最小的时候,其对应的y值是多少。

可以设置阈值来识别空间上孤立的三角形,示例代码如下:

from shapely.geometry import Polygon

coords1 = [(54.950899, 60.169158), (54.953492, 60.169158), (54.950958, 60.169990)]
poly1 = Polygon(coords1)

coords2 = [(24.950899, 60.169158), (24.953492, 60.169158), (24.950958, 60.169990)]
poly2 = Polygon(coords2)

poly1.distance(poly2)

poly1.distance(poly1)

采用随机多边形可以参考
https://automating-gis-processes.github.io/site/index.html
从不规则网格中选择多边形以移除孤立的单元格,在Stack Overflow上找到一个类似的问题
https://stackoverflow.com/questions/61460077/